## Timeline

- **2026-06-22**: Zali Steggall tables truth in political advertising bill — Bill introduced to parliament proposing a Political Advertising Standards Board, mandatory AI labelling, and fines up to $300,000 for deceptive ads.

- **2026-06-21**: Campaign donations reach $4.7 million — One Nation's 'fire the liar' campaign reports $4.7M in total donations, making it the party's most lucrative fundraising drive.

- **2026-05**: One Nation launches 'fire the liar' campaign — Campaign launched following federal budget broken promises on capital gains tax, employing unlabeled AI-generated imagery.
